Lower end of a vertical capillary tube is dipped in water and rise of water in the tube is found to be h. Now if the lower end of a capillary tube of radius 2r is dipped in water and the tube is made inclined at an angle of 30o with horizontal, the rise of water in the tube will be 

a
2h
b
4h
c
h
d
h2

detailed solution

Correct option is C

For vertical tube, h=2TρrgFor inclined tube, T x 2π x 2r=π(2r)2y.ρg.sin30oy=2Tρrg=h
